What Maintenance Is Required for Misting Systems?

To sustain your misting system, you’ll need to regularly clean the nozzles and filters to prevent clogs. Check for leaks and guarantee proper water pressure, following the installation guidelines for peak performance. Conducting a cost analysis helps you budget for replacement parts or upgrades. Additionally, inspect the pump and tubing for wear. Keeping up with these tasks will extend the life of your system and ensure it runs efficiently.

How Do I Choose the Right Misting System for My Space?

Choosing the right misting system for your space is like finding the perfect pair of shoes; it must fit just right. First, consider the room size—larger areas may need high-pressure mist systems, while smaller spaces can work with low-pressure options. Then, evaluate mist system types: wall-mounted, portable, or ceiling-mounted. Match the system to your needs, ensuring it effectively cools and enhances comfort without overwhelming the space.
